A HAR Analyser That Stays in Your Browser
Starting this weekend, I built HAR Insight a browser-based tool for looking at HTTP Archive (HAR) files. You can try it at har.thelazysre.com
The main idea: analysis runs on your machine. Your data doesn’t go anywhere unless you explicitly use the optional sharing or AI features. I wanted something I could use (and point others at) without uploading sensitive captures to a third party. Here’s what it does and why I built it that way.
